base

pdk
tasks
Provides a base system provisioning.

PuppetOps

puppetops

2,604 downloads

2,604 latest version

5.0 quality score

Version information

  • 1.0.0 (latest)
released Jul 18th 2019
This version is compatible with:
  • Puppet Enterprise 2019.8.x, 2019.7.x, 2019.5.x, 2019.4.x, 2019.3.x, 2019.2.x, 2019.1.x, 2019.0.x, 2018.1.x, 2017.3.x, 2017.2.x, 2016.4.x
  • Puppet >= 4.10.0 < 7.0.0
  • CentOS
    ,
    RedHat
    , Archlinux
Tasks:
  • update

Start using this module

Documentation

puppetops/base — version 1.0.0 Jul 18th 2019

base

Build Status

Table of Contents

  1. Description
  2. Setup - The basics of getting started with base
  3. Usage - Configuration options and additional functionality

Description

The base module provides a base provisioning for all systems Puppet interacts with.

Setup

What base affects

Because the base module is used to provide a provisioned baseline, it affects the system extensively. This includes:

  • A number of OS-specific packages installed.
  • Services enabled and set to running.
  • Basic system hardening via sysctl configuration files.

Usage

The base module is used by simply including it in the most basic Puppet profile:

include base